For companies experienced with operating internationally, PacTac provides expertise on government assistance and incentives in the Asia/Pacific region. As with domestic site selection, incentives are a key part of the international site selection process. PacTac works with companies specifically on the incentives package for each site under consideration, analyzing both mandated and negotiated incentives available at each site. That package--the incentives, concessions and infrastructure provisions, as well as the financing in many cases--is a critical part of the site selection process. PacTac Advisors will involve the public, private, and financial sectors, first in analyzing what may be available, and then in developing and negotiating the optimum package for each location.

For companies new to operating facilities overseas, PacTac provides broader services, in addition to the assistance with government incentives described above. PacTac also works with clients to identify key international issues in considering sites outside the United States. This focuses on management and cultural issues, as well as building the site analysis matrix for the project. PacTac's strongest geographic expertise is in the Asia/Pacific region, where PacTac Advisors principals travel regularly and have extensive government and service provider contacts. These local service providers are real estate specialists, architects, interior designers, business consultants, legal firms, and accounting firms. They are typically indigenous companies, long established in their home countries and well informed on local issues. These are the firms that know not only the current regulations, but also the direction their governments are likely to take on future issues. Some have regional representation, but most operate only in their home countries. These experts are brought into projects by PacTac to provide PacTac's clients with the level of local knowledge not available when a single firm does the entire international site search.
